Female - Drapery Study1864 – 1865 Accession number: 1904P111 Pencil and red-brown chalk on cream-toned paper, laid down. Width: 153 mm Height: 330 mm InformationOne of a series of female drapery studies, originating from a sketchbook, for an as yet unidentified subject, although possibly a female saint or martyr of the early Church. The figure wears drapery similar in style to ancient classical costume, with one shoulder exposed, and there is a sketch of a nimbus around the left side of the head.
